🎙️ Next-Level Audio & Camera Controls

1 Audio Zoom Lens Isolation

One of the most impressive camera technologies available on premium smartphones today is Audio Zoom. When recording a video in a crowded environment, your device can focus its microphones toward the same area your camera is zooming into. This allows the phone to reduce surrounding noise while emphasizing the audio source associated with your visual subject.
Imagine recording a street performer in a noisy city square — the phone prioritizes the performer’s voice or music. Content creators, vloggers, and journalists can dramatically improve recording quality using this feature.

2 Micro-Scrubbing Audio Precision

Ever accidentally skipped several minutes while trying to find a specific point in an audiobook or podcast? Micro-scrubbing solves that problem.
Simply hold the progress bar and drag your finger downward while continuing to move left or right. As your finger moves farther from the timeline, the scrubbing speed becomes increasingly precise. This technique allows frame-by-frame navigation in many media applications.

4 Screen Recording Audio Separation

Creating tutorials, gaming videos, or educational content becomes easier when you separate internal system audio from microphone input. Many users don't realize that long-pressing the screen recording button often reveals advanced audio options. You can record: Internal system sounds only / Microphone audio only / Both simultaneously. This helps eliminate unwanted background conversations.

6 Animation Scale Acceleration

One of the fastest ways to make an Android phone feel dramatically faster is reducing animation scales. Navigate to Developer Options and change:

SettingDefaultRecommended
Window Animation1.0x0.5x
Transition Animation1.0x0.5x
Animator Duration1.0x0.5x
Menus open faster, applications feel more responsive, and older devices gain a noticeable speed boost.

7 Progressive Web Apps (PWAs)

Many popular services now offer excellent PWAs. Instead of installing resource-heavy apps: open website → tap "Add to Home Screen" → launch like a normal app. PWAs consume less storage, fewer background resources, and less battery while maintaining nearly identical functionality.

8 Bluetooth Dual Audio Streaming

Watching a movie with a friend on a plane? Modern smartphones support simultaneous audio output to multiple Bluetooth devices. This feature allows two pairs of headphones or speakers to receive the same audio stream without additional hardware.

🔋 Battery, Charging & Thermal Management

13 Safe Phone Cooling Methods

When a phone overheats, never put it in a refrigerator (rapid temp changes create condensation). Instead: Remove the case, place the phone on a cool surface (stone, ceramic, metal), avoid direct sunlight, stop heavy processing tasks. Metal surfaces often help dissipate heat safely.

14 Detect Battery-Hogging Apps

Total battery usage statistics can be misleading. A better metric is battery consumption relative to active usage time. If an app consumes a large % of battery during only a few minutes of use, it may be running inefficient background processes. Regular battery audits dramatically improve battery life.

19 Print-to-PDF Trick

One of the most useful productivity hacks: converting virtually any page into a PDF. When viewing content: Select Share → Choose Print → Open Print Preview → Save as PDF. Works for tickets, receipts, webpages, invoices, and important documents.

❓ Frequently Asked Questions

1. Do these smartphone tricks work on both Android and iPhone?

Many of them work on both platforms, although the exact settings and menu locations may differ depending on your device model and operating system version.

2. Is reducing animation scale safe?

Yes. Lowering animation scales only changes visual transition speed and does not damage your device or affect system stability.

3. Do Progressive Web Apps really save battery?

In many cases, yes. PWAs typically consume fewer resources than full native applications because they run in a lighter environment.

4. Can dual Bluetooth audio reduce sound quality?

Most modern devices maintain excellent audio quality during dual streaming, though battery consumption may increase slightly.

5. Is it safe to download apps from alternative repositories?

Only if the repository verifies application signatures and maintains strong security standards. Always use trusted sources and avoid unknown websites.
